Morag Macdonald is highly regarded for her extensive experience leading complex patent litigation. In addition to her disputes practice, she expertly handles IP-driven transactions.
Morag's biggest strength is her strategic oversight; she organises the cases across different jurisdictions and makes sure all the different attorneys know what they are doing.

Katharine Stephens draws on her deep litigation experience to handle complex trade mark and design disputes for leading brands. She has additional expertise in copyright and database rights. Recently, she is acting for clients in the AI sector.
Katharine is well informed, particularly around AI, and always speaks very sensibly.

Ewan Grist has extensive experience in a range of complex disputes and enforcement matters regarding patents, trade marks and design rights. He is particularly well versed in trade mark infringement litigation for major retail brands.
Ewan is a very good practitioner. He is very amenable and very sensible.
Nicole Jadeja is an expert in the treatment of patents in commercial and contentious matters. She is particularly well known for work in biotech and pharmaceuticals.
Nicole Jadeja is very, very good, particularly on the patent litigation side.
Toby Bond is noted for his knowledge and experience in the tech space, particularly in relation to EU regulations covering AI, data and SEP matters. He has an impressive patent and copyright practice and regularly represents clients in the UK Courts as well as in multi-jurisdictional litigation.
Toby is a brilliant IP lawyer; his advice is very commercial and relevant to the tech industry. He is a software engineer by background and can 'talk the talk' with our business teams.
